Folio 430: William Bligh, Admiralty. Requesting an additional week's leave to assist the delay in the production of his equipment.
Folios 431-433: enclosure with folio 430. Report dated August 1798 by William Bligh to the Admiralty. Description and use of an instrument, invented by William Bligh, to regulate naval evolutions for the readily taking bearings of land or ships when sudden emergency will not allow time to use a compass for that purpose.
